Using XMP to Overclock RAM Image Credit: Intel Intel gives you the … WebUnless your PSU is absolute hot garbage tier, it will have Over Current Protection (OCP). If you try to pull too much current through a PSU with OCP, it will simply cut power for a second causing a reboot (and often an audible "click"). WebCPU Core Ratio, or multiplier, determines the speed of your CPU. The overall speed of your processor is calculated by multiplying the base clock speed (BCLK) by this ratio. For … WebDec 4, 2024 · Overclocking refers to pushing the clock speed of your processor past its rated limit. Clock speed is the number of cycles your CPU can complete in a second, and it’s measured in hertz. So, a...

You can check if the CPU is being overclocked under the Windows System properties page. Right-click on "This Computer/PC" etc. Select properties. Under the system heading, you should see processor, and there it will show it's @speed and maximum speed. citizenship studies journalWebSep 15, 2024 · CAS latency is a measure of how many clock cycles there are between the READ command being sent to the memory stick and the CPU getting a response back.
